National Broadcasting Day 2022


  • On July 23, India celebrates the National Broadcasting Day, with the aim of reminding people regarding the impact of radio on our lives. 
  • It marks the establishment of first-ever radio broadcast “All India Radio (AIR)” in India.
  •  All India Radio (AIR) celebrated the day by holding a symposium on Creation of New India and Broadcasting Medium in New Delhi.
  • Indian radio played an important role in creating an independent India.
  • Azad Hind Radio of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ose as well as Congress Radio helped uniting Indians to fight against the British.
  • Akashvani also helped Bangladesh in gaining independence from Pakistan in 1971 war.
